Output 0478374519599b4d64db5d8bc6f94bbd9ae333cbdc4e1ca802d13c46e7c11986:0

value
45848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ece359925afae010e1275bb245956ed47282bd1 OP_EQUAL
address
3ALJUFgLWCXsaZko89sq6ekssJeqcvoknf
transaction
0478374519599b4d64db5d8bc6f94bbd9ae333cbdc4e1ca802d13c46e7c11986
confirmations
224076
spent
true